10 Simple Ways to Update Your Website

Marketing· Websites

30 Apr

I’ve said it before and I’ll say it again – having a beautifully designed, user-friendly and fully functional website is one of the best things you can do to ensure that you have a successful online business. Your website is often the first point of contact for potential clients and customers… and you never get a second chance to make a first impression! Yet so many of us leave our website stale and neglected, spending too much time updating our Instagram feed and not enough time showering our website with the TLC it deserves.

Not only does a frequently updated site provide your visitors with a more positive experience, it will also increase the number of returning visitors, encourage people to spend longer on your site, help to boost your SEO and ultimately convert your visitors into paying clients or customers. And we all know that more conversions = more $$$ for your business!

With this in mind, I’ve put together 10 simple ways to update your website below…

1. Update your images

A quick cosmetic fix can make the world of difference! Start off by swapping your bio image for something a little newer. Then challenge yourself to update at least 5 other images on your site. These could be your page header images, a carousel on your home page, your ‘about us’ images, images of your team or office, product images or even sprucing up your site logo.

2. Create new headlines or page names

Another small update to your website that can make a huge impact in the overall appearance. Ensure that your page names are still relevant and reflect your products and services. While you’re at it, make sure they are strong, thought provoking and spark curiosity in your visitors, so that they feel compelled to read every word you have to say.

3. Create a new mailing list sign up form and incentive

You’ve worked so hard to get these visitors to land on your site, so you may as well make the most of them being here by capturing their data so you can get in touch with them in the future! Email marketing is SO important for online businesses, which you can read more about by clicking here. Make sure there are ample opportunities for site visitors to sign up to your mailing list by creating new embedded forms and pop-ups throughout your website. Better still, create an entirely new incentive or freebie to keep your visitors interested and encourage even more sign ups.

4. Update your ‘About Me’ and your bio

These are often the first elements of a website that we write, but also the parts that are most often neglected. Update your location, how many years you’ve been in business, your brand statement, your vision for the future of your brand, add in some company news, your recent achievements and your business milestones. Don’t be afraid to celebrate your wins!

5. Create a new blog post

This is one of the best ways to regularly update your website, providing your visitors with fresh, relevant and exciting new content to connect with each time they come back. To find out more info on why your business needs a blog and how to get it started, click here.

6. Add new client or customer testimonials

Social proof is a fantastic way to encourage people to make a decision in your favour, such as signing up to your emailing list, following you on social media or purchasing your product or service. When you get amazing feedback or reviews, make sure you plaster that goodness all over your site – don’t just keep it hidden on a ‘testimonials’ page. Add these testimonials to your bio, your product pages, your sidebars, your footers, your checkout carts and anywhere else that would help to nudge your potential customers in the right direction.

7. Create a monthly or weekly featured product or service

Think of this as an opportunity to shine the spotlight on one of your products or services by adding it to your homepage in a ‘product of the week’ or ‘most popular service’ featured area. A great way to bring attention to different areas of your business or inventory, as well as a super simple way to update your website!

8. Share your recent work

If you sell products, sharing your latest collections and items is probably a no-brainer. However many people in the service industries often forget to update their portfolios and case studies. Sharing your recent work is a great way to showcase your skills and provide your potential clients with a visual demonstration of your awesome capabilities!

9. Live stream your social channels

By adding a live Instagram, Facebook or Twitter feed to your website, your site will be constantly updated without you having to worry about it! Whatever you post on your social media channels will automatically appear on your website, creating fresh visual content and a new opportunity to convert your website visitors to social media followers.

10. Revamp your site completely!

If your initial DIY attempt is now looking unprofessional or outdated, or your inventory has outgrown your current sites capabilities, or maybe your business is desperate for a total rebrand – you might just need to bite the bullet and give your website a full makeover with a completely fresh theme, branding, images, copy and functionality.
